The great R. V. Jones, who is best known and quoted in seismology for his work with
capacitive sensors, while at Aberdeen invented a modified optical lever that uses Ronchi
rulings.  Ronchi is in this modern era largely unknown, but his contributions in the field of
figure-testing of optical components was of truly great significance.  Those who want to
study Jones' system can download the following paper:
http://iopscience.iop.org/0950-7671/38/2/301/pdf
What is most remarkable about the coarse gratings (Ronchi rulings) used for this work is that
they work with ordinary (non-monochromatic) light from an incandescent bulb.  I have for
about two decades demonstrated to students the physics of this remakable system by means of a
spherical mirror in which the white light bulb/grating combination is situated at the center
of curvature.
    To those who are impressed by observing displacements as small as a nanometer, consider
the following:  In the 1960 paper referenced above, Jones claims a resolution of 0.1 nrad!
It should be noted that this device is not a simple (standard) optical lever where one
typically is limited to tenths of a microradian;  Jones combined Ronchi rulings with the
optical lever to produce a whole new concept--much better for seismic purposes, if anybody
